Why Kids Yoga? Because Children Need Mindful Spaces Too
Kids yoga is so much more than wiggly poses and cute games (though there will be plenty of those!).
Jayme’s approach nurtures the whole child—mind, body, and soul. Each class integrates:
Mindfulness practices
Breathing techniques
Relaxation strategies
Age-appropriate yoga postures
Creative, playful movement
Social-emotional skill building
Children learn how to connect with their inner selves, develop self-awareness, and cultivate compassion for themselves and others. They also learn practical tools for calming their nervous systems, focusing their minds, and expressing themselves in healthy ways; skills that support them well beyond the studio.
And because kids learn best through play, imagination, and movement, everything is delivered in a way that feels light-hearted, engaging, and FUN.

Meet Jayme: Certified Teacher, Experienced Yogini, and Heart-Led Educator
Jayme is a certified elementary and secondary health teacher, an adult & kids yoga instructor, and the founder of Emerald Kids Yoga. Her passion for teaching light-hearted, playful yoga has only deepened since becoming a mother herself.
Before stepping fully into the yoga world, Jayme spent over seven years teaching kindergarten in Idaho and Nevada. She incorporated breathwork and yoga practices right into her classroom curriculum, quickly noticing how deeply it benefitted all students, regardless of temperament or learning style.
With more than twenty years of personal yoga practice, Jayme brings both depth and warmth to her kids classes. She completed her RYT 200 through Mountain Yoga Sandy and her RCYT (Registered Children’s Yoga Teacher) certification through Yoginos: Yoga for Youth.
